A registered agent plays a crucial duty in the legal and management framework of an organization entity, working as the main point of contact in between the firm and the state federal government. Their primary duty is to get lawful documents, such as service of procedure notifications, tax obligation notifications, and official government correspondence, on behalf of the business. This role guarantees that the firm remains compliant with state regulations which crucial documents are handled without delay and safely. A registered agent must preserve a physical address within the state where the organization is registered, which is obtainable throughout typical service hours. This requirement guarantees that the federal government and lawful entities have a dependable location to supply important records, avoiding problems like missed target dates or lawful difficulties. Beyond obtaining documents, registered agents usually aid with compliance issues, consisting of timely filing of annual reports or various other necessary filings mandated by the state. They also function as a point of contact for any lawful inquiries or requests associated with the company, providing a layer of privacy for local business owner by managing main document on the surface. Choosing a qualified registered agent can assist a service simplify its lawful interactions and reduce the risk of missing out on vital due dates or notifications. In general, their duty is integral to maintaining the lawful standing of an organization and ensuring smooth interaction with government companies and lawful entities.
